A Great Neck man stopped for speeding Tuesday on the Wantagh State Parkway in Levittown was driving with a license that had been suspended 42 times, State Police said.

Shawn White, 39, was driving a gray Ford van at 76 mph in a posted 55 mph zone, north on the parkway near Hempstead Turnpike, at about 11:50 a.m., police said.

Troopers said White drove several blocks after exiting the parkway and ran a stop sign before pulling over.

White's license was checked, and troopers said they discovered it had been suspended 42 times and that the plates on his vehicle also had been suspended.

White was arrested and charged with felony unlicensed operation of a vehicle, driving with a suspended registration and traffic violations.

His arraignment information was not immediately available.
